Audacity 1.2.6


Windows has absolutely no ‘Audacity’ to provide good audio editing programs. This multi-platform open source editor is great at what it does. It has 32-bit floating point audio, a clean uncluttered interface, good plug-in support and project management features.

This editor can record and play sounds and import WAV, AIFF, MP3, and OGG as well as FLAC with this version right out-of-the-box. You can freely edit using cut, copy, and paste features, with unlimited undo functionality, mix tracks, and use the eye-catching Beat Analyzer.

The program also has a built-in amplitude-envelope editor, a customizable spectroprogram mode, and a frequency-analysis window for audio-analysis applications. Built-in effects include bass boost, wah wah, and noise removal. The program also supports VST plug-in effects.

Don’t expect this to be a commercial program such as Cool Edit Pro or Sony’s Soundforge but if you are looking for a free feature-rich audio editor, it doesn’t get better than this.

For: Powerful audio editor, additional plug-in support.
Against: needs more features but we are only being picky.
